Super League Referees Announced for Round Nine

The officiating teams for the upcoming Round Nine fixtures in the Super League have been confirmed. Notably, Chris Kendall has been granted a week off after personally requesting the time away from the RFL Referees’ team.

The action kicks off on Thursday as league leaders St Helens, fresh off a dominant 58-0 victory over Hull FC, host an in-form Huddersfield Giants side coming off an impressive 30-24 win over Leeds Rhinos. Liam Moore will take charge as the referee, with Ben Thaler supporting as the video official.

Friday sees a double-header, with struggling sides Castleford Tigers and London Broncos looking to secure a much-needed win. Jack Smith will referee this encounter, with Marcus Griffiths as the video official. Elsewhere, the Leigh Leopards welcome Catalans Dragons, with Aaron Moore as the man in the middle and James Vella in the video booth.

The final Friday fixture pits Hull KR against Wigan Warriors, following the Robins’ heavy defeat to Catalans last time out. Tom Grant will referee, while Liam Moore takes on video official duties.

Salford Red Devils, buoyed by the news that Paul Rowley will remain at the club, host Warrington Wolves on Saturday, with James Vella as the referee and Tom Grant as the video official.

The round concludes on Sunday as Hull FC, bolstered by new signings, take on Leeds Rhinos. Liam Rush will be the referee, with Jack Smith as the video official.
